Columbia Asset Management increased its position in Chevron Co. (NYSE:CVX – Free Report) by 9.9% in the 2nd quarter, according to the company in its most recent Form 13F fil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ission. The firm owned 37,613 shares of the oil and gas company’s stock after buying an additional 3,392 shares during the quarter. Chevron comprises approximately 1.1% of Columbia Asset Management’s holdings, making the stock its 25th largest position. Columbia Asset Management’s holdings in Chevron were worth $5,883,000 at the end of the most recent quarter.

Chevron Stock Down 0.8 %
Shares of NYSE:CVX opened at $140.95 on Friday. The company has a 50 day moving average price of $151.18 and a two-hundred day moving average price of $155.37.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.13, a quick ratio of 0.85 and a current ratio of 1.16. The company has a market capitalization of $257.79 billion, a PE ratio of 12.97, a PEG ratio of 2.50 and a beta of 1.09. Chevron Co. has a 52 week low of $139.62 and a 52 week high of $171.70.
Chevron Dividend Announcement
The firm also recently declared a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Tuesday, September 10th. Stockholders of record on Monday, August 19th will be given a dividend of $1.63 per share. This represents a $6.52 dividend on an annualized basis and a dividend yield of 4.63%. The ex-dividend date of this dividend is Monday, August 19th. Chevron’s dividend payout ratio is currently 59.98%.

Chevron Profile
Chevron Corporation, through its subsidiaries, engages in the integrated energy and chemicals operations in the United States and internationally. The company operates in two segments, Upstream and Downstream. The Upstream segment is involved in the exploration, development, production, and transportation of crude oil and natural gas; processing, liquefaction, transportation, and regasification of liquefied natural gas; transportation of crude oil through pipelines; transportation, storage, and marketing of natural gas; and carbon capture and storage, as well as a gas-to-liquids plant.
